To convert Milli-Oersted (mOe) to Gilbert per Inch (Gb/in), multiply the value by 0.00254. The conversion factor is based on standardized unit definitions and is suitable for engineering analysis, system design, and professional measurement workflows.
Convert 1 mOe to Gb/in.
So, 1 mOe = 0.00254 Gb/in.
